The Community Foundation for Crawford County is pleased to introduce Kendra Stahl, a 2018 recipient of one of the two James E. Huggins, Sr. and Margaret M. Huggins Agricultural Scholarship awards.

Kendra, the daughter of Michael and Jill Stahl, is a 2018 graduate of Buckeye Central High School. She plans to attend Wilmington College this fall and study agronomy.

Experiences and accomplishments in her FFA Chapter inspired Kendra to choose her major. “In my FFA, I participated in the county soil competition, eventually making it to state, and won the competition as a team and also individually,” she stated. “For here my team went to nationals to win fourth place. After this experience, I became very interested in what all can be done with this skill.” After graduation, Kendra intends to come back to the area. “My career goal after I graduate is to find a job working for a local company,” she explained. “With this job, I want to learn and grow, but also help and support the community that has always been there for me. A career in this field would mean the most to me because it is in an area that I have been [familiar with] my whole life, and I would be giving back to the community.”
